The present invention provides a browser based
mass three-dimensional
point cloud data release method. The method comprises the following steps that S1. a bounding box of original three-dimensional
point cloud data is calculated, and block division is carried out on the original three-dimensional
point cloud data according to the bounding box and a
regular grid division theory, so as to divide a plurality of block point cloud bounding boxes; S2. an
octree is established for each block point cloud bounding box, and a description file is configured for each
octree; S3.
regular grid division is carried out on a point cloud
octree, and a
quadtree structure is established for the octree contained in each
regular grid; and S4. a browser sends in real time a query request to a
server, the
server returns in real time an octree query result to the browser, the browser carries out
visibility determination on the octree query result, and the visible octree is loaded, so as to complete
dynamic loading and scheduling of
mass three-dimensional point
cloud data. According to the method disclosed by the present invention, web based release and
visualization of
mass large point cloud files are realized, and the problem that point
cloud data is difficult to release is solved.